Stone pelting incidents have reduced in JK: BJP leader

Press Trust of India  |  Jammu 

Incidents of stone pelting have reduced in due to the central government's move, state general secretary, Harinder Gupta claimed today.

"The struck a severe blow to stone-pelters and terrorists by clamping down on their funds and militants in Kashmir have lost access to all their reserves and their desperation was evident in robbery attempts," he told reporters here.


Stone pelting incidents in Kashmir have come down from 2,683 in November 2015- October 2016 to 639 November 2016 to July 2017 as result of demonetisation, the leader claimed.
